There is one upside to Marlon’s relapse...

-

Mark Charnock is extraordin­ary in his compelling performanc­e as Marlon struggles after suffering a stroke. Events take another turn for the worse when he ends up in hospital again and is diagnosed with aspiration pneumonia. It’s a step backwards for Rhona and him, and Paddy is shocked when Bear blames himself. At least Rhona (above, with Marlon) will have no time to buy another hat, a prop that made her look as though she’d had a close encounter with a woolly mammoth. When she gave it to April a couple of weeks back, the child couldn’t have looked less pleased than if she’d lost an iPad and had it replaced with an Etch A Sketch.

The drugszzzzz­z tedium keeps dragging on when Suzy is seen with a bag of white powder; suffice to say that she’s not planning to ice a cake with it. Celebratin­g their deal with Eddie, Suzy and Leyla enjoy their coke (not the cola kind – getting the drift here?), but will Vanessa guess what the pair are up to when she walks in on them?

Noah has returned to extremely creepy mode and finds himself having to hide in the wardrobe while snooping around Chloe’s bedroom. It gives a whole new meaning to being in the closet.
